Latest Patents
One of Wu's latest patents is titled "Semiconductor device and method of forming the same." This innovative method involves several steps, including forming a gate stack over a substrate, creating an amorphized region adjacent to the gate stack, and applying a stress film over the substrate. The process further includes forming a dislocation with a pinchoff point in the substrate, removing part of the dislocation to create a recess cavity, and finally forming a source/drain feature within that cavity.
